Explore the intricacies of Kondo screening and random singlet formation in highly disordered systems through this 35-minute conference talk delivered at the II ICTP-SAIFR Condensed Matter Theory in the Metropolis event. Delve into the research presented by Eric Andrade from USP São Carlos, examining the complex interplay between these phenomena in condensed matter physics. Gain insights into the latest developments in this field and enhance your understanding of quantum impurity problems in disordered environments.
